Asphalt Sprayer Market Overview

The global Asphalt Sprayer Market size estimated at USD 2016.02 million in 2026 and is projected to reach USD 2804.65 million by 2035, growing at a CAGR of 3.74% from 2026 to 2035.

The asphalt sprayer market market is expanding due to increasing global road infrastructure projects, with over 64 million kilometers of roads worldwide requiring maintenance and construction support. Asphalt sprayers play a critical role in uniform bitumen distribution, with tank capacities ranging between 500 liters and 12,000 liters. By Type

Hand Push Asphalt Sprayer

Hand push asphalt sprayers account for 17% of the market and are widely used in smallscale road repair projects. These sprayers typically have tank capacities between 200 liters and 800 liters, making them suitable for localized applications. Adoption rates have increased by 14% in rural areas due to lower costs and ease of operation. Labor dependency remains high at 65%, but operational costs are reduced by 22% compared to larger equipment. Usage frequency in municipal repair projects stands at 39%, with maintenance intervals averaging 12 months.

Trailed Asphalt Sprayer

Trailed asphalt sprayers hold a 28% market share and are preferred for mediumscale road construction projects. These units feature tank capacities ranging from 1,000 liters to 6,000 liters and are typically towed by trucks. Efficiency improvements of 26% have been achieved through enhanced pump systems and spray bar technology. Adoption in developing regions accounts for 34% of total usage due to costeffectiveness. Operational flexibility has increased by 21%, allowing deployment across diverse terrains and project sizes.
